The company’s solution works by getting to know users, understanding where they stand in terms of healthcare needs and connecting them with an Accolade “health assistant.” Accolade says its solutions help minimize the amount of information patients need to keep track of and saves time because whenever they need assistance with anything healthcare-related, they reach out to one person who already knows everything about their care. Employers that partner with Accolade are able offer the service to their workforce.
Including the new funding, Accolade has raised more than $90 million this round. The company plans to use the new funding to expand its technology platform, R&D, and sales and marketing.
